Pages from the Past - From the 137-year history of the Kiowa County Press - January 21, 2024

Kiowa County Press historic front page.

15 Years Ago - January 16, 2009

  • Wild Horse Roundup- Curtis Schrimp: We watched a program on TV about the dust bowl days that brought back memories. The government was buying cattle $20 for the best ones, $10 the poorest and those they just shot.

25 Years Ago - January 15, 1999

  • USDA Update- Rod Johnson: A very mild winter to date with exceptions of some very cold temperatures over the holidays. The wheat should be coming out of dormancy in about a month, so wet snowfall would be beneficial.

40 Years Ago - January 20, 1984

  • Nancy Barnes of Towner has been named “1983 Kiowa County Farm Wife.”
  • “I’ve lived in these parts for 60 years and I’ve never seen it this cold said one ‘old timer’ living in Eads.” Temperature dropped to -27.
  • Nursing Home News- LaVerne Fischer: Nine members of the Karval Keenagers arrived to entertain. They come the second Wednesday of each month.

50 Years Ago - January 18, 1974

  • “The baking industry is trying to ‘hoodwink’ the American public,” according to members of the Colorado Wheat Administrative Committee. Recently, the American Bakers Association made the assertion the nation is going to run out of wheat without imports.
